## Tuning

The `vramscope` profiler samples allocator state on a fixed interval and snapshots fragmentation metrics per stream. Reviewers should verify that sampling overhead stays under two percent on the Tessowl benchmark suite; raising the interval trades resolution for throughput. The defaults, validated against both discrete and integrated targets, are as follows:

tuning table, faweg-bajep:
WEIGHTS = {
    "belius": 690,
    "eliox": 458,
    "norax": 616,
    "praion": 132,
    "zorvan": 911,
}

/*
 * Fixture: stale-refresh regression for the Cardelia session service.
 * Background: tokens refreshed within 5s of expiry were issued with the
 * OLD expiry timestamp, so clients entered a refresh loop and hammered
 * the auth tier. The fix clamps issued expiry to now + TTL. This fixture
 * reproduces the race by freezing the clock 3s before expiry and firing
 * two concurrent refresh calls. Maintainers: keep the timing margins
 * intact or the race disappears. The fixture authenticates with the
 * bearer token on the following line.
 */

portal login ticket: eyJhbGciOiJIUzI1NiIsInR5cCI6IkpXVCJ9.eyJzdWIiOiIwEOsktwVNwIn0.-UJU3fdyyCgG

### Step 4 — Seed the pricing experiment tables

Applies to the Farebridge ticket-pricing experiment. Run migration 0042 to add the variant and exposure tables, then backfill the last 14 days of purchase events. Idempotent; safe to rerun. Verify row counts match the events log before enabling the feature flag. The backfill job targets the experiments database using the connection string below.

replica DSN, kajep-yahag: mssql://praok_svc:iF@db-8d68.plorvaio.local:5432/eliion

Subject: DR drill — InvoiceForge renderer, Thursday

Welcome aboard. Thursday's drill simulates total loss of the InvoiceForge PDF rendering cluster in the Dunmere region. Your role: restore the renderer from the cold snapshot, verify font embedding, and confirm a test invoice renders identically to the golden copy. You'll need access to the sealed restore account, which stays dormant outside drills. Do not reset it; doing so invalidates the escrow. The account's recovery passphrase is recorded below.

vault phrase of kajop-kaweg = sorix-istys-noviel